Strikeforce ‘Melendez vs. Healy’ Gets Welterweight Scrap Between Nah-Shon Burrell, Yuri Villefort




Welterweights Nah-Shon Burrell and Yuri Villefort are the latest additions to Strikeforce “Melendez vs. Healy”

Promotion officials announced the pairing on Thursday, making nine fights now official for the Sept. 29 event, which takes place at the Power Balance Pavilion in Sacramento, Calif. The evening’s main draw airs on premium cable network Showtime and is headlined by a titular lightweight title confrontation between Gilbert Melendez and Pat Healy. The preliminary draw immediately precedes the main card broadcast and airs on sister network Showtime Extreme.

Burrell, 22, recently saw a six-fight winning streak snapped when he suffered a first-round technical knockout at the hands of lanky foe Chris Spang. That May 19 setback served as Burrell’s first Strikeforce defeat, as “The Rock-N-Rolla” previously earned victories over Joe Ray, Lukasz Les and James Terry in his first three promotional outings.

Like his opponent, Villefort, 21, was also bested on May 19 in his most recent in-cage appearance, dropping a split decision to Quinn Mulhern at “Barnett vs. Cormier.” The bout was the first in nearly two years for Villefort, who underwent knee surgery last summer. Widely regarded as one of the welterweight division’s top prospects, the Floridian earned five finishes in his first six fights as a professional.
